Stone backsplash installation services involve the process of fitting natural or manufactured stone materials onto kitchen or bathroom walls behind sinks, stoves, or countertops. This service typically includes selecting appropriate stone types, preparing the wall surface, and precisely installing the material to achieve a durable and visually appealing finish. Skilled contractors ensure that the stones are securely adhered, properly aligned, and sealed to prevent moisture penetration, resulting in a resilient surface that enhances the overall aesthetic of the space.

One common problem stone backsplash installation helps address is the need for a protective barrier against water, stains, and heat in areas prone to splashes and spills. A properly installed stone backsplash not only guards the wall surface but also adds a layer of style and texture to the room. It can prevent damage to underlying drywall or paint, reducing the likelihood of mold, rot, or deterioration caused by constant exposure to moisture. Material Costs - The cost of stone backsplash materials can range from approximately $10 to $50 per square foot, depending on the type of stone selected. For example, natural stone like marble or granite may be on the higher end of the spectrum.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ific material choices.

Labor Expenses - Installation labor typically costs between $20 and $50 per hour, with total project costs varying based on the size and complexity of the backsplash. A standard kitchen backsplash installation might range from $300 to $1,500 in labor fees.

Project Size - The overall cost is influenced by the size of the area to be covered, with larger surfaces increasing the total price. For example, a small backsplash might cost around $200, while a full kitchen installation could reach $2,500 or more.

Additional Costs - Extra expenses may include surface preparation, removal of old backsplash, and sealing, which can add several hundred dollars to the total. These costs vary based on the project's scope and the condition of the existing surface.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of stone are suitable for a backsplash? Local pros can install a variety of stone materials such as granite, marble, quartzite, and slate, depending on the desired look and durability requirements.

How long does stone backsplash installation typically take? The duration varies based on the size of the area and complexity of the design, but most installations are completed within a few days by experienced contractors.

Can stone backsplashes be installed over existing surfaces? Yes, in many cases, stone backsplashes can be installed over existing surfaces, but a professional assessment is recommended to ensure proper adhesion and finish.

What maintenance is required for a stone backsplash? Regular cleaning with mild, non-abrasive cleaners is usually sufficient; sealing may be recommended periodically to maintain appearance and durability.

Are there design options available for stone backsplash layouts? Yes, local professionals offer various layout options, including herringbone, subway, and mosaic patterns, to complement different kitchen styles.
